What This Climate Does to an Aging Deck
Driving Rain and Wind-Driven Moisture
Storms moving through this part of the county rarely drop rain straight down. Wind pushes it sideways, up under railings, and into the gap where a deck ledger meets the house — exactly the spots a deck's structure depends on staying dry. A deck surface that sheds a light, calm rain just fine can still trap wind-driven moisture at a butt joint or a fastener hole, and that's usually where repair problems start, out of sight underneath the decking boards rather than on top of them.
Salt-Tinged Air and Valley Damp Working Together
Sumas doesn't sit on the water the way Blaine does, so it doesn't take the same steady dose of salt spray a shorefront deck gets. But storm systems moving in off the Strait carry salt-influenced moisture inland on windy, wet weather, and it settles into a valley floor that already holds humidity longer than higher, more exposed ground. That combination is harder on exposed metal — fasteners, brackets, post hardware — than a dry inland climate would be, and corrosion on those connections tends to start well before it's visible from the top of the deck.
A Moss Season That Runs Most of the Year
Mild temperatures and near-constant dampness give moss and mildew a long growing season across Whatcom County, and a horizontal deck surface holds water longer between rain events than a vertical wall ever does. Shaded decks and north-facing surfaces are usually first to show it. Moss buildup isn't just a slip hazard — it holds moisture directly against the board surface, which is exactly the condition that leads to soft, rotting boards underneath a coat of green growth that looks worse than it structurally is, or sometimes better.
Freeze-Thaw Cycling in Winter
Sumas sees more frequent hard frosts than towns closer to the water, and that adds a freeze-thaw dimension to any moisture that's already worked its way into a board, a post base, or a framing connection. Water that's soaked into wood or a porous material and then freezes expands, and that cycle repeated over a winter accelerates cracking and splitting in a way a purely wet-but-mild climate wouldn't.
Signs Your Sumas Deck Needs Repair
Most deck problems give some warning before they become a safety issue, if you know where to look. A few things worth checking before the wet season sets in:
- Soft, spongy, or bouncy spots underfoot, especially near the house or around stairs
- Moss, algae, or dark staining that returns quickly after cleaning
- Rust streaks running down from fasteners, brackets, or railing hardware
- Railing posts that wiggle or flex more than they used to
- Visible gaps, cracking, or separation where the deck ledger meets the house
- Boards that have cupped, split, or pulled away from their fasteners
- Stair stringers that feel uneven or have visible cracking at the notches
- A musty smell or visible mold underneath the deck, particularly near the ledger
Repair vs. Replacement: Making the Right Call
Not every deck problem in Sumas calls for a full tear-off, and not every deck is worth patching. The honest answer depends on how much of the structure is affected and whether moisture has been getting in for a season or for several years.
| Situation | Usually Repairable | Usually Needs Replacement |
|---|---|---|
| Damage location | Isolated to a few boards, one railing section, or a single post | Widespread across multiple framing members or the full deck surface |
| Framing condition | Joists and beams still solid, with a localized soft spot | Multiple joists soft, cracked, or showing rot at connections |
| Ledger connection | Flashing failed but ledger board itself is sound | Ledger board itself is rotted or pulling away from the house |
| Age and material | Newer deck with an isolated failure point | Older deck built to outdated fastening or flashing standards |
| History | Damage found early, limited moisture exposure | Water has clearly been tracking in for multiple seasons |

What a Correct Deck Repair Involves
Ledger Board and Flashing
The ledger board, where the deck attaches to the house, is one of the most common points of failure and one of the most important to get right. If flashing there has failed and water has been tracking behind it, a repair needs to correct the flashing detail itself, not just patch the visible damage, or the same failure comes back within a season or two.
Framing and Joist Repair
A soft or rotted joist can often be sistered — a new piece of framing fastened alongside the damaged one to restore structural capacity — rather than requiring a full substructure rebuild, provided the damage hasn't spread too far. We check adjacent framing members too, since rot at one joist is a sign the same moisture exposure has likely started working on its neighbors.
Fastener and Hardware Corrosion
Given the salt-influenced storms and sustained valley moisture this area sees, corroding fasteners and brackets are a repair item on their own even when the wood around them still looks fine. We replace compromised hardware with stainless or corrosion-resistant fasteners rated for this kind of exposure, not standard hardware that will just start corroding again on the same timeline.
Board Replacement and Matching
Replacing individual boards on an existing deck means matching species, profile, and where possible finish to the surrounding material, whether that's wood or composite. On composite decking, exact color matching gets harder the older the deck is, since boards fade slightly over time — we'll be upfront if a perfect match isn't realistic so there are no surprises at the end of the job.
Railings and Stairs
Loose or wobbly railing posts are a safety item, not a cosmetic one, and the fix usually involves getting down to solid framing to re-anchor the post correctly rather than just tightening what's there. Stair stringers with cracking at the notched sections carry structural load with every step, and repair there means addressing the stringer itself, not just replacing a worn tread.

Deck Repair Cost Factors in This Area
| Factor | What It Affects | Why It Matters Here |
|---|---|---|
| Extent of framing damage | How much of the substructure needs sistering or rebuilding | Sustained valley moisture and freeze-thaw cycling can spread rot further than it first appears |
| Ledger condition | Whether flashing alone needs correction or the ledger itself needs replacing | Wind-driven rain concentrates moisture right at this connection point |
| Fastener and hardware condition | How much hardware needs upgrading to corrosion-resistant grade | Salt-tinged storm moisture accelerates corrosion on standard fasteners |
| Material match | Board replacement cost and how closely new material blends with existing | Older composite decking fades unevenly, which can affect how seamless a repair looks |
| Access and site conditions | Labor time for elevated decks, tight crawl space access underneath, or rural site layout | Many Sumas properties sit on larger rural or farm lots with different access than an in-town yard |

How Our Process Works
We start with a hands-on inspection — walking the deck surface, checking railings and stairs, and getting underneath to look at the framing, ledger connection, and any fastener corrosion that isn't visible from on top. From there we lay out what we found in plain terms: what's cosmetic, what's structural, and whether a repair or a fuller rebuild makes more sense given the extent of the damage. If it's a repair, we scope the work to what actually needs doing rather than turning a targeted fix into a bigger job than it has to be.
Once the scope is agreed on, repair work generally follows structure-first order: framing and ledger corrections first, since everything else attaches to or depends on those, followed by fastener and hardware replacement, then decking boards, railings, and stairs. We finish with a walkthrough covering what the repaired sections need going forward and what, if anything, suggests the rest of the deck is heading toward needing attention down the road.
